Javon McCrea heads to Spirou

Javon McCrea (201 cm, Buffalo’14) has agreed to terms with Proximus Spirou Chareleroi (Belgium-Scooore League) this 2016. He heads back to Europe after playing 12 games for Cangrejeros de Santurce (Puerto Rico-BSN). In his brief run in Puerto Rico, McCrea posted averages of 16.3 ppg and 8.4 rpg. Tu Holloway back with Guaros

Tu Holloway (182 cm, Xavier’12) has reunited with former team Guaros de Lara (Venezuela-LPB) this 2016. He scored five points and handed out one assist in seven minutes of action in his first game back. The good news is his team won that game against Gaiteros.
